Patsy Cline and Loretta Lynn were both recording for Decca and working with producer Owen Bradley in the early '60s, but this isn't a reissue of duets cut by the two singers. The album simply alternates between tracks by Lynn and tracks by Cline; Lynn predominates, performing seven of the 10 songs.
It's an all-gospel program which reprises three tunes well-known to any Patsy Cline fan: "Just a Closer Walk With Thee," "Life's Railway to Heaven" and "If I Could See the World Through the Eyes of a Child." This last tune is followed by Lynn's "When I Hear My Children Pray," featuring an uncredited child's vocal and a lengthy rhyming recitation. The production leans towards the glossy, with strings, background vocals, and polite piano fills. Unfortunately, like many MCA reissues, this one includes no songwriting, session personnel, or recording date information. $12.89 Robert Earl Keen is an archetypical Texas singer/songwriter, someone who can mine both laughter and tragedy from life along the dusty margins of life in the Lone Star State, and seeing that he's been recording good-to-great albums of his material since 1984, a comprehensive and well-programmed compilation offering a fully rounded introduction to his music would be more than welcome. However, 2007's Best isn't quite that album. While Keen had recorded a dozen albums by the time this was released, Best draws its 17 tunes from only six discs, two of which are live albums and three of which (Farm Fresh Onions, What I Really Mean and Live at the Ryman) are relatively recent efforts that presumably dominate the second half of this collection because they were easy to license rather than because they represent Keen's finest work. Quite frankly, a number of Keen's best songs are missing, such as "Dreadful Selfish Crime," "The Front Porch Song" and "I Wonder Where My Baby Is Tonight," while fan favorites like "The Five Pound Bass," "The Buckin' Song," "Barbecue" and "The Bluegrass Widow" don't make the cut, either. That said, if Best doesn't quite present Keen's best material (or even all his best known), there's little arguing that what's here is great stuff; Keen, who compiled this disc, has edited a satisfying sampler, hitting a graceful balance between crowd pleasers like "Merry Christmas from the Family" and "The Road Goes on Forever" (the latter prefaced by a rambling story in which Keen loses his car and his girl but meets Willie Nelson) and more resonant numbers like "Corpus Christi Bay," "Whenever Kindness Fails" and "For Love."
